DojoClip is a free video background remover that runs entirely in your browser. It is built for presenters, talking-head footage, dance and fitness clips, and other videos where a person is the foreground. After the matte is generated, changing the background is instant because the model does not need to process the source again.
The tool separates a person from the surrounding scene using AI portrait matting, so ordinary footage works — no chroma key or studio setup required. It does not erase a selected object and reconstruct the pixels hidden behind it. For the cleanest result, use footage with a clearly visible person, steady lighting, and reasonable contrast between clothing and the background.

No. The AI estimates a person matte directly from normal footage. A green screen can still improve edge quality, but it is not required.
No. The model is downloaded to your browser and your source video is processed locally on your device.
Not in this version. MODNet is designed for people. Arbitrary object selection and object erasing require different models.
Browser support for transparent video encoding is inconsistent. This version exports the person composited over your selected background.
Portrait matting estimates partial transparency around fine details. Motion blur, low contrast, and heavy compression can reduce edge quality.
